Flooding can cut off electricity at the exact time people need power most. Homes may lose access to lighting and phone charging, businesses may be unable to operate, and clinics or temporary shelters may struggle to keep essential equipment running.
A reliable mobile power supply flood emergency service helps move temporary electricity solutions to locations affected by rising water, blocked roads or damaged infrastructure. Depending on the situation, this may involve portable generators, battery power stations, inverters, solar backup units or larger mobile generator sets.
The equipment alone is not enough. Safe transport, correct sizing, suitable installation and proper fuel planning all matter when power is being delivered into a flooded environment.
Work Out What Actually Needs to Stay Powered
The first step is deciding which appliances or systems are essential. Trying to power an entire building may require a much larger generator than keeping only basic equipment running.
Emergency power is commonly needed for:
- Lights and phone charging
- Water pumping equipment
- Refrigerators and freezers
- Medical devices
- Communication systems
- Security equipment
- Computers and payment terminals
- Fans and basic office appliances
A household may only need a portable power station for lighting, phones and a small fan. A pharmacy, supermarket or health facility may require a generator capable of supporting refrigeration and other high-demand equipment.
List the appliances, their power ratings and the expected operating hours before arranging delivery. This helps avoid sending equipment that is too small or unnecessarily expensive.
Flooded Roads Change the Delivery Plan
A normal delivery vehicle may not be able to reach the property once water rises. The safest approach is to confirm road conditions shortly before dispatch.
The receiver should provide recent photos, videos and information about the nearest accessible landmark. In parts of Lekki, Ajah, Ikorodu, Port Harcourt or Yenagoa, the equipment may need to be delivered to a dry transfer point rather than directly to the building.
From there, smaller equipment may be moved using a suitable boat or another approved method. Heavy generators require more careful coordination because ordinary passenger boats may not safely support their weight.

Protect Power Equipment From Water
Generators, batteries and inverter systems should not be placed directly on wet ground. They need a raised, stable and dry operating surface.
Sensitive parts such as control panels, sockets, cables and battery terminals should remain protected during transport. Waterproof covering can reduce exposure to rain, but the equipment must still receive proper ventilation when operating.
Generators should never be run inside bedrooms, corridors, enclosed shops or poorly ventilated spaces. Exhaust fumes can build up quickly and create a serious health risk.
Cables should also be kept away from standing water. Improvised connections, damaged extension leads and exposed wires should not be used during an emergency.
Plan Fuel and Battery Runtime Before Dispatch
A generator without enough fuel or a power station with insufficient battery capacity may stop working before the emergency is over.
Confirm:
- Expected operating hours
- Estimated fuel consumption
- Available fuel storage
- Whether refuelling will be possible
- Battery charging requirements
- The availability of solar panels or grid power
Fuel should be transported in approved containers and kept away from ignition sources. Do not send loose petrol containers inside the same enclosed space as passengers.
For battery-powered systems, check whether the unit can support the required appliances continuously or only for a few hours.
What to Provide When Requesting Emergency Power
Accurate details make it easier to select the right equipment and vehicle.
Provide the exact location, nearest dry access point, type of building, appliances to be powered and expected duration of use. Also state whether the site has stairs, narrow entrances or limited space for unloading.
For larger generators, confirm whether lifting equipment or additional handlers will be required. Sending a heavy unit without a practical unloading plan can delay the entire response.
